The federal government has increasingly been engaging in public-private partnerships (P3) as a way in which to fund projects.  A huge portion of these partnerships involves conservation and land use, but not to the advantage of Idahoans.  Rep. Simpson was previously involved in the Boulder-White Clouds designation as a wilderness and actively engaged with the Idaho Conservation League to get that accomplished.  Aside from his alliance with non-governmental organizations (NGO), who they themselves are heavily financed by foundations, he is now taking a direct turn to corporate troughs for their endless pit of money, money that is often used to suck up land for non-use, known as syndicated conservation easements.

Sen. Risch and Idaho Fish & Game have also turned to corporate money to fund conservation.  It seems Rep. Simpson has adopted that approach.  Along with Rep. Kilmer (D-WA), Rep. Simpson introduced the Land and National Park Deferred Maintenance (LAND) Act.  Federal “investment” using corporate profits?  Using energy revenues, this bill would “…permanently reauthorize LWCF and create new dedicated funding to address the maintenance backlog at National Parks and other public lands.”.  The Land and Water Conservation Fund (LWCF) was allowed to expire September 30, 2018, and for good reason.  As Rep. Bishop points out, the original LWCF intent was to “preserve, develop and ensure access to outdoor recreation facilities” splitting money between state funding and federal land acquisition, with 60 percent going to states.  Because of intense lobbying by environmental groups, the majority of that money now goes to the federal government for land acquisition, having added another 5 million acres of land under federal control.
